    You will install, repair, and rehabilitate municipal water and sewer collection systems with a focus on cured-in-place pipe (CIPP) and trenchless methods. Work includes main and service installs, tapping, valve and hydrant work, sewer cleaning, CCTV inspection, and CIPP lateral/mainline rehab with steam or UV cure and flow bypass management. Key Responsibilities - Field Technician - Jet-Vac/CCTV Operator (CDL) Install and repair water distribution lines from drawings; utility locates; pavement sawcut; trench, set pipe, fittings, valves, hydrants; backfill, compact, restore; flush lines and collect samples for EPA reporting. Perform main taps and service installs: size selection, hot taps, curb stops, meter wells/meters; shutoffs/turn-ons. Maintain water assets: rotate valves, flush hydrants, repair/replace valves/hydrants, repair main and service breaks, install/test/repair meters; insulate meter pits. Construct and repair sewer collection: lay new services, jet clean lines, dye tests, replace broken sections, raise/seal manholes, set traffic control. Execute CIPP rehab: access prep, bypass pumping, cleaning and CCTV, liner measurement and wet-out, inversion or pull-in, steam/UV cure, cool-down, lateral reinstatement, post-CCTV and QA records. Operate equipment: dump truck, backhoe, mini-excavator, sewer jet/vac, tanker, trenchers, tampers, compressors, jackhammers, cutoff saws, tile cutters, pumps, tapping tools, hand/power tools. Service equipment: grease/oil, replace hydraulic and high-pressure hoses, inspect fluids, coordinate preventive maintenance, clean/repair hand tools. Safety/compliance: confined space entry, atmospheric monitoring, lockout/tagout, excavation safety, traffic control, digital documentation on tablet/laptop. Other related duties as assigned.     The Utility System Operator is assigned coverage of LVAHCS Sousley Campus for Facilities Management Service and the Medical Center. The Utility Systems Operator operates, maintains and repairs three 500 HP Cleaver-Brooks low pressure gas and oil fired tube boilers rated at 12 PSI with a total capacity of 52,500 pounds of steam per hour, two 950-ton Carrier centrifugal chillers, one Mcquay 1500 ton centrifugal chiller, and all auxiliary components of each system. A Johnson Controls Metasys Facility Management Computer System (FMS) controls and monitors the entire Cooper Drive Division (CDD) heating, ventilation and air conditioning (HVAC) and environmental systems. As the Utility Systems Operator, the incumbent's duties include, but are not limited to: * Familiarity with the operation of chiller plant equipment. * Make independent decisions on the need to adjust, start or stop equipment to maintain energy efficiency. * Operate, maintain, and repair high/low pressure steam boilers and condensing boilers. * Recommends changes to schedules, priorities, and work sequences as necessary and make minor deviations in procedures or redirect resources under their control to overcome problems. * Follows all departmental policies and procedures. * Reviews electronic information including technical manuals and electronic drawings. * Monitors pertinent information from gauges and thermometers, graphs, indicators, and other technical measuring devices. * Interprets blueprints, diagrams, instructions and specifications. * Understands critical alarms related to HVAC units, medical vacuum, medical air, oxygen, fire, fire dampers, life support equipment in surgery, recovery, coronary care, etc. * Ensures inspections and adjustments are in accordance with set guidelines for operations. * Familiarity with hand and power tools, calibration equipment, and chemical titration equipment. * Maintain water treatment in the cooling towers, distribution systems and boilers, per instructions and chemical vendors recommendations. * Utilize working knowledge of boilers, air conditioning and refrigeration equipment, controls and auxiliary machinery and equipment. * Monitors and provides assistance with shutting down and resetting elevator operations and sewage lift station. Work Schedule:Monday thru Sunday 24 hours a day, 8 hr shifts that rotate Position Description Title/PD#: Utility Systems Operator/PD30043A Physical Requirements: The Utility Systems Operator must sometimes lift weight in excess of 50 pounds. At times works awkward and cramped positions. Must work from ladders while using hand-tools or holding a heavy object overhead. frequent standing, walking and climbing is also required. Utility Systems Operator will monitor and operate the FMS and ambient conditions, making independent decisions on the need to start and stop equipment.
